Benghazi Wasn't An Embassy

I'm not blowing hot air. It wasn't me who said it. In this official state department document it was they themselves who said it. "In December 2011, the Under Secretary for Management approved a one-year continuation of the U.S. Special Mission in Benghazi, which was never a consulate and never formally notified to the Libyan government.". The document further stated, "The Board found that Ambassador Stevens made the decision to travel to Benghazi independently of Washington, per standard practice."
